Canadian metal band SNAKE EYES SEVEN are preparing to release there long awaited second album . The Madman Cole Stevens and the new boys Ken Stone ( Thunder Struck AC/DC tribute singer ), Moscow on the bass and Johnny (put the pedal to the metal ) Bland. Their mind crushing self titled debut album , met with great reviews and Snake Head fans wanting more. Label CHAVIS RECORDS says HOLY SHIT the fans are going to be blown away. Recorded at Titan Sound in Edmonton this past year and produced by Cam Macloud ( White Wolf ) . The new album called Thirteen Crows has thirteen mind blowing songs showing the bands diverse stamina to all genres . Release date TBA with tour dates and new merch ..
